Capabilities & Use Cases
The DeploymentAdminClient API, provided as part of the Microsoft Azure deployment governance ecosystem, is a programmatic interface designed for the centralized management of software product packages at an enterprise scale. Its core function is to perform lifecycle operations on product package resources—specifically retrieving, creating or updating, and deleting these artifacts—within a specific Azure subscription scope. This API is foundational for organizations managing a portfolio of cloud-native applications, services, or virtual machine images that need consistent deployment and versioning. Typical use cases include IT administrators governing a catalog of approved software for internal business units, platform teams managing deployment packages for a suite of microservices, or independent software vendors (ISVs) automating the distribution and update process of their multi-tenant offerings across multiple customer subscriptions. It provides the backend control plane for ensuring deployment consistency, compliance, and version traceability across complex cloud environments.

🛡️Security & Auth
Critical configuration considerations for this API center on its authentication model. While the endpoint specifications indicate "None" for explicit API key or token authentication in the provided description, in practice, such Microsoft services are secured via Azure's identity and access management system. Calls must be authenticated using Azure Active Directory (Azure AD) credentials with appropriate permissions, typically as an owner or contributor role at the subscription level, or via a custom role with specific permissions like "Microsoft.Deployment.Admin/productPackages/read/write/delete." Best practices dictate strictly adhering to the principle of least privilege; create dedicated service principals or managed identities for the AI agent's access, granting only the necessary permissions (e.g., read-only for auditing, or write access scoped to a single resource group for updates). Developers should ensure the MCP server configuration securely manages these Azure AD tokens, never exposing them in logs or client-side code, and should implement robust audit logging for all actions performed via the AI agent to maintain a secure and compliant operational trail.
